Flamingo Tango in Mexico’s Rio Lagartos

Flamingos

If you’re visiting Mexico’s Yucatan Peninsula and want to see some of the area’s wildlife, it’s hard to beat a trip to Rio Lagartos. The sleepy fishing village lies roughly half way along the peninsula’s northern shore, straight north of Valladolid. It borders the Ria Lagartos Biosphere Reserve, a sprawling mangrove-lined estuary with phenomenal bird life. The biggest draw is flamingos.
